I had lipo about four years ago. About 10 pounds of fat were sucked out of my tummy and midriff areas. At the time, I was about 60 pounds overweight (still am) but my stomach was sagging and looked horrible when wearing bathing suits, etc. I was very self conscious.

For a birthday gift, my sister paid for the surgery. It was successful and my stomach was a lot tighter. I was still overweight, but I didn't feel as fat. Over the last couple of years, I gained weight. Most of it didn't go into the liposuctioned areas. Instead, it went to other areas and especially into the breast area where I least needed it. Even though I recently lost 25 pounds, my breast size hasn't changed yet and I still have difficulty getting clothes to fit properly.

The surgery itself is safe when performed by experienced physicians under the right circumstances. The recuperation period was difficult to say the least. If I had to do it again knowing what I know now, I would say for me it probably wasn't worth it at that point in my life. Maybe it would have been after I was closer to my ideal weight and still had a sagging tummy.
